Default Livingston mini-convention

They call it a 'mini convention' but it's really a pretty decent amateur radio rally. One of the few in Scotland. I've acquired quite a few nice bits and piece here in previous years. To give an idea of the sort of stuff which turns up:

Zeiss stereo microscope
AR88
KW/Decca 109 Supermatch
Glassfibre antenna pole sections
HP 486A noise source
Various components
A few rolls of Multicore lead/tin solder.
HP 40v 5A power supply

The organisers routinely get me to give one of the talks so that everyone else can get a clear shot at the goodies on the stalls for an hour....
